High Sierra Collision – NWS Urgent Winter Weather Message

Brought to you by High Sierra Collision

The National Weather Service has issued an Urgent Winter Weather Message warning that a quick-moving storm will produce heavy snow overnight and into the morning hours.

According to the NWS we can expect periods of moderate to heavy snow here on the valley floor. The heaviest snow should fall before 5:00a.m.

NWS Snow accumulation predictions: 3 TO 6 INCHES WEST OF HIGHWAY 395…WITH 2 TO 4 INCHES EAST OF HIGHWAY 395 INCLUDING THE SURPRISE VALLEY AND NORTHERN WASHOE COUNTY.

Visibility at times during the early morning hours is expected to be less than one-half mile.
